AIHL Awards
The Australian Ice Hockey League have announced the award winners for the 2023 AIHL season:
Playoffs MVP: Liam Hughes (Melbourne Mustangs)
Most Valuable Player: Scott Timmins (Melbourne Mustangs)
Defenceman of the Year: Ty Wishart (Melbourne Mustangs)
Goaltender of the Year: Andrew Masters (Central Coast Rhinos)
Rookie of the Year: Riley Klugerman (Newcastle Northstars)
Coach of the Year: Benjamin Breault (Perth Thunder)
AIHL says no to Rhinos comeback
Some days ago icehockeynewsaustralia.com reported the intention of Central Coast Rhinos to rejoin Australian Ice Hockey League (AIHL) after a five years hiatus. But AIHL Annual General Meeting rejected the request without further explanations
